Trump Tweets, Liberals Go Nuclear (https://www.commentarymagazine.com/politics-ideas/trump-tweets-liberals-go-nuclear-weapons/)


Donald Trump has done it again. The president-elect has taken to his Twitter account to articulate a shift in American national-security policy with grave geopolitical implications that cannot be understated. At least, that’s what the left would have you believe. This increasingly rote response represents another chapter in the voluminous annals of liberal overreaction to the president-elect’s social-media musings.

“The United States must greatly strengthen and expand its nuclear capability until such time as the world comes to its senses regarding nukes,” wrote President-elect Trump on Thursday. When it comes to Trump and Twitter, the left is already on edge. Add nuclear weapons to the mix, and you have a recipe for a stage-four meltdown.

Who knows what inspired the tweet or what Trump precisely meant by it? This assertion might have been the result of a meeting Trump took with Pentagon officials on Wednesday, including the Deputy Chief of Staff for Strategic Deterrence and Nuclear Integration. Or it may have been Trump’s response to having been briefed on the results of Russian President Vladimir Putin’s year-end meeting with defense chiefs in which the Russian autocrat pledged a nuclear-modernization push in 2017.

Trump was clearly avoiding specificity and to identify a detailed policy proposal in this tweet requires some divination on the part of individual observers. That didn’t stop the left from both dissecting this tweet and coming to one preordained conclusion: “We’re all going to die.”...
